The railroad needs a specific civil infrastructure due to the technical requirements that are necessary for a correct interaction with the rolling stock. In this sense, the analysis of the dynamics of the train itself with the infrastructure is particularly relevant. The railroad platform, as well as the bridges, viaducts and tunnels used, although they are similar from a constructive point of view to those used in other areas, have specific particularities for case of the railroad due to this interaction.

Based on the above, the postgraduate certificate in Civil Railroad Infrastructure will address the technical analysis of all these elements, taking into account their characteristics, components and specificities considering such interaction. As it is to be expected, the study of the railroad track in its traditional conception, with ballast, and in slab, as well as the devices used for its operation, such as turnouts, are also covered here.

It should be noted that this program will also incorporate the analysis of the so-called infrastructure resilience. This is a discipline that has gained great importance in recent years and that studies the impact of different aspects, such as climate change, on the infrastructure itself.
